Sql Training by Experts

;

Our Training Process

Sql - Syllabus, Fees & Duration

Module 1: Introduction to Databases and SQL

    What is a Database?

  • Introduction to databases and their importance
  • Types of databases: Relational, NoSQL, etc.
  • Introduction to SQL

  • History and purpose of SQL
  • Basic SQL terminology (tables, rows, columns, etc.)
  • Setting Up SQL Environment

  • Installing database management systems (e.g., MySQL, PostgreSQL)
  • Installing SQL clients (e.g., MySQL Workbench, pgAdmin)

    Module 2: SQL Basics

    SQL Data Types

  • Common data types (e.g., INT, VARCHAR, DATE)
  • Choosing the right data type for columns
  • Creating and Managing Tables

  • Creating tables using CREATE TABLE
  • Altering tables using ALTER TABLE
  • Deleting tables using DROP TABLE
  • Inserting and Manipulating Data

  • INSERT, UPDATE, and DELETE statements
  • Understanding SQL transactions
  • Module 3: Querying Data

    SELECT Statement

  • Retrieving data from tables
  • Using SELECT DISTINCT and aliases
  • Filtering and Sorting Data

  • WHERE clause for filtering
  • ORDER BY clause for sorting

    Aggregate Functions

  • SUM, AVG, COUNT, MIN, MAX
  • GROUP BY and HAVING clauses
  • Module 4: Joins and Relationships

    Understanding Relationships

  • Primary keys and foreign keys
  • Types of relationships: one-to-one, one-to-many, many-to-many
  • INNER JOIN and OUTER JOIN

  • Joining tables to retrieve related data
  • LEFT JOIN, RIGHT JOIN, FULL JOIN
  • Subqueries

  • Using subqueries to retrieve data
  • Correlated subqueries
  • Module 5: Advanced SQL Concepts

    Indexes and Performance Optimization

  • Creating and managing indexes
  • Query optimization techniques
  • Views

  • Creating and using views
  • Advantages of using views
  • Stored Procedures and Functions

  • Creating and executing stored procedures
  • Creating and executing user-defined functions
  • Module 6: Transactions and Concurrency

    Transactions

  • ACID properties
  • Managing transactions using COMMIT and ROLLBACK
  • Locking and Concurrency Control

  • Understanding locks and their types
  • Handling concurrent database access
  • Module 7: Security and Permissions

    User Accounts and Permissions

  • Creating and managing user accounts
  • Granting and revoking privileges
  • SQL Injection Prevention

  • Protecting against SQL injection attacks
  • Best practices for secure coding
  • Module 8: Case Studies and Real-world Applications

    Building SQL Applications

  • Developing a simple web application with a database backend
  • Data Modeling

  • Entity-Relationship Diagrams (ERD)
  • Normalization techniques
  • Module 9: Reporting and Business Intelligence (Optional)

    Introduction to Reporting Tools

  • Using SQL for generating reports
  • Integration with reporting tools like Tableau, Power BI, etc.
  • Module 10: NoSQL and Big Data (Optional)

    Introduction to NoSQL databases

  • Overview of popular NoSQL databases (e.g., MongoDB, Cassandra)
  • SQL in the context of Big Data

  • Basics of working with large datasets
  • Module 11: Advanced Topics (Optional)

    Window Functions

  • Understanding window functions for advanced querying
  • JSON and XML Processing

  • Working with JSON and XML data in SQL
 
10000+
20+
50+
25+

Sql Jobs in Canada

Enjoy the demand

Find jobs related to Sql in search engines (Google, Bing, Yahoo) and recruitment websites (monsterindia, placementindia, naukri, jobsNEAR.in, indeed.co.in, shine.com etc.) based in Canada, chennai and europe countries. You can find many jobs for freshers related to the job positions in Canada.

  • sql developer
  • data engineer
  • data analyst
  • sql database administrator
  • ml sql developer
  • microsoft sql developer
  • oracle sql developer
  • mysql developer

Sql Internship/Course Details

Sql internship jobs in Canada
Sql We provide sql training and internship in Canada in real time projects. A comprehensive SQL training syllabus should cover the fundamentals of SQL (Structured Query Language) and gradually progress to more advanced topics. You can learn sql from industry experts in Canada. Here's a suggested syllabus for SQL training, divided into different modules: This syllabus is designed to provide a comprehensive understanding of SQL, from the basics to more advanced topics. Depending on the level of expertise required and the time available for training, you can customize the syllabus to fit your specific needs. Additionally, hands-on practice and real-world projects should be integrated throughout the training to reinforce the concepts learned. .

Meet a Few of our Industry Experts 🚀 Your Pathway to IT Career

Danish

Mobile: +91 9446600368
Location: Mumbai, Online (Canada)
Qualification: Diploma in Computer Engineering

Experience: I have been a solo Android developer in my current company This company focuses on digitalizing universities and schools I  more..

Satheeshmohan

Mobile: +91 9446600368
Location: Tamil Nadu, Online (Canada)
Qualification: MCA

Experience: Manual and automation testing |   more..

Ashish

Mobile: +91 98474 90866
Location: Kerala, Online (Canada)
Qualification: Bachelor of Technology

Experience: My skill and expertise involves webapp penetration testing network penetration testing wireless penetration testing scripting Source code analysis   more..

Yousaf

Mobile: +91 89210 61945
Location: Kerala, Online (Canada)
Qualification: Bachelor’s of computer application

Experience: I am a dedicated Python Django Developer with a Bachelor's degree in Computer Application and over 1 2 years of  more..

Anagha

Mobile: +91 98474 90866
Location: Kerala, Online (Canada)
Qualification: Bsc computer science

Experience: A Django backend developer excels in building robust web applications Key skills include proficiency in Python and Django database management  more..

Dev

Mobile: +91 91884 77559
Location: Pune, Online (Canada)
Qualification: B.A.

Experience: My skills - Html css java script react node sql Exp - total 2 yrs of experience in web development  more..

Pavithra

Mobile: +91 98474 90866
Location: Andhra Pradesh, Online (Canada)
Qualification: Btech(computer science)

Experience: python java html php and sql I'm currently working as a data engineer   more..

Khushi

Mobile: +91 9895490866
Location: Maharashtra, Online (Canada)
Qualification: MCA

Experience: I am well-suited for this role due to my extensive experience and proficiency in key web development skills As a  more..

Sharique

Mobile: +91 9895490866
Location: Maharashtra, Online (Canada)
Qualification: BSC

Experience: Experience of 3 3+ years in different testing level such as Functional testing Regression testing Integration testing Black Box testing  more..

supriya

Mobile: +91 98474 90866
Location: udupi, Online (Canada)
Qualification: bcom

Experience: photoshop canva wordpress ms office At present working as social media manager for Dlos digital marketing  more..

Rohit

Mobile: +91 89210 61945
Location: Maharashtra, Online (Canada)
Qualification: B.E.

Experience: Selenium Core Java TestNG Cucumber manual Testing Automation Testing Java Scripting RTM Test Cases Test Scenarios Test Planning ROHIT WAGHMARE  more..

Durga

Mobile: +91 9446600368
Location: Andhra Pradesh, Online (Canada)
Qualification: B.Tech

Experience: I have a strong foundation in python programming and full stack development languages like html CSS JavaScript frameworks bootstrap noe  more..

Lukhman

Mobile: +91 89210 61945
Location: Karnataka, Online (Canada)
Qualification: Be computer science

Experience: Java sql html css networking  more..

Nebi

Mobile: +91 91884 77559
Location: Kochi, Online (Canada)
Qualification: Btech EC

Experience: I have completed my btech in 2018 And i have experience as a business development executive(2yrs)and also as embedded engineer(1yr)  more..

Dharshini

Mobile: +91 9446600368
Location: Tamil Nadu, Online (Canada)
Qualification: B.E CSE

Experience: I am confident that my dedication to continuous learning coupled with my technical expertise aligns well with the innovative and  more..

Sithara

Mobile: +91 8301010866
Location: India, Online (Canada)
Qualification: BCA

Experience: Full stack development   more..

somya

Mobile: +91 9895490866
Location: Rajasthan, Online (Canada)
Qualification: mca

Experience: as per my technical skill i have work in react js with tailwinds and a basic knowledge of docker devops  more..

Pavanraddi

Mobile: +91 91884 77559
Location: Banglore, Online (Canada)
Qualification: Bachelor of engineering

Experience: Manual testing API testing Java jira agileApplication for Software Testing  more..

Subhashini

Mobile: +91 91884 77559
Location: Karnataka, Online (Canada)
Qualification: V. Sc, MBA

Experience: I have done my Manual software testing at Mazenet solutions |   more..

Krishna

Mobile: +91 9895490866
Location: Mumbai, Online (Canada)
Qualification: Bachelor of Engineering

Experience: Dear Recruiter I am writing in response to the Software Test Engineer position I have 1 3 Year of experience  more..

Geerthana

Mobile: +91 9895490866
Location: Coimbatore, Online (Canada)
Qualification: BE cse

Experience: I had an experience in both manual and automation testing known some frameworks like Testng bdd with cucumber data driven  more..

Akash

Mobile: +91 89210 61945
Location: Kerala, Online (Canada)
Qualification: Puls two

Experience: Critical thinking python django team work SQL non SQL react  more..

Ch.

Mobile: +91 91884 77559
Location: Andhra Pradesh, Online (Canada)
Qualification: Degree

Experience: Web page design photo shop html css javascript adobexd  more..

SONA

Mobile: +91 8301010866
Location: Malappuram, Online (Canada)
Qualification: Bsc computer

Experience: python css javascript boostrap htmlApplication for Python Django  more..

Sanith

Mobile: +91 9895490866
Location: Kerala, Online (Canada)
Qualification: BCA

Experience: I have skilled with software requirement analysis designing and maintaining test case report and bug report and knowledge in Redmine  more..

Pinal

Mobile: +91 98474 90866
Location: Maharashtra, Online (Canada)
Qualification: Bachelor of science in computer science

Experience: I have done mean stack development certificate course and I know about manual testing Currently working at RapidQube Digital Solutions  more..

Pranay

Mobile: +91 89210 61945
Location: Rajasthan, Online (Canada)
Qualification: Btech

Experience: Skills : Plugin and theme development PHP Javascript AJAX Wordpress HTML CSS  more..

Priyesh

Mobile: +91 98474 90866
Location: Kerala, Online (Canada)
Qualification: BCA ,

Experience: I worked on a dubai based company last 2 years as a software engineer currently iam resign and stay back  more..

Varshaba

Mobile: +91 91884 77559
Location: Gujarat, Online (Canada)
Qualification: M.Tech Cyber security

Experience: SOC Analyst VulnerabilityAssessment Network security and forensics Owaps Top 10 Pentesting testing Incident Investigation  more..

Darshana

Mobile: +91 9895490866
Location: Kannur, Online (Canada)
Qualification: MCA

Experience: Manual Testing Python UI testing test case preparation Communication skills presentation skills | Resume for   more..

Umarani

Mobile: +91 9446600368
Location: Tamil Nadu, Online (Canada)
Qualification: MCA

Experience: Html Css Bootstrap Software Manual tester Willing to learn Automation testing  more..

Sanjib

Mobile: +91 89210 61945
Location: Delhi, Online (Canada)
Qualification: BAHons.

Experience: UI UX designer and developer  more..

Udhaya

Mobile: +91 91884 77559
Location: Tamil Nadu, Online (Canada)
Qualification: MBA

Experience: With experience In graphic design I am proficient in Adobe Illustrator Photoshop premiere pro I have successfully designed logos Instagram  more..

Adarsh

Mobile: +91 91884 77559
Location: Kerala, Online (Canada)
Qualification: B Tech

Experience: Results-driven DevOps Engineer with one year of experience in automating optimizing and maintaining deployments in AWS environments Skilled in Infrastructure  more..

Sowmya

Mobile: +91 9446600368
Location: Karnataka, Online (Canada)
Qualification: B Tech ( computer science and technology)

Experience: C Java html and CSS and SQL I have certification on selenium webDriver with Java-Basics to Advanced Framework I have  more..

Rakendu

Mobile: +91 98474 90866
Location: Vaikom, Online (Canada)
Qualification: BTech

Experience: Doing Certification in SOFTWARE TESTING from ICFOSS Nearly 3 years of experience from Cognizant Technology Solutions in JAVA done Manual  more..

Gowtham

Mobile: +91 98474 90866
Location: Tamil Nadu, Online (Canada)
Qualification: BE

Experience: Dart kotlin Android SDK flutter figma ui git socket firebase payment gateway  more..

Priya

Mobile: +91 91884 77559
Location: Mumbai, Online (Canada)
Qualification: Bachelor of engineering

Experience: 3 years of experience in selenium java sanity testing smoke testing retesting regression Test case Execution test case design database  more..

Mrunali

Mobile: +91 9895490866
Location: Pube, Online (Canada)
Qualification: MCA

Experience: 3 2 years of experience in manual as well as Automation Testing load testing with jmeter knowledge of bdd framework  more..

Dinesh

Mobile: +91 89210 61945
Location: Ambala, Online (Canada)
Qualification: Bca

Experience: Software testing or6months experience  more..

Bhagyashree

Mobile: +91 98474 90866
Location: Maharashtra, Online (Canada)
Qualification: Bcs

Experience: Manual testing SQL java  more..

Dhiraj

Mobile: +91 9895490866
Location: Maharashtra, Online (Canada)
Qualification: Bachelor of engineering

Experience: I worked on 2 3 projects in Mern stack I have little bit knowledge in Java I completed web development  more..

shubham

Mobile: +91 98474 90866
Location: Delhi, Online (Canada)
Qualification: BCA

Experience: I am responsible for take care of the application task what ever I have to provided by organization I have  more..

Komal

Mobile: +91 91884 77559
Location: Maharashtra, Online (Canada)
Qualification: BE

Experience: I am fresher but I have done internsip in wordpress Developer that reason i have knowledge about this position   more..

Shilpa

Mobile: +91 8301010866
Location: Kochi, Online (Canada)
Qualification: Diploma in CS

Experience: I have don 6month internship as a software testing   more..

Pavankumar

Mobile: +91 98474 90866
Location: Karnataka, Online (Canada)
Qualification: BCA

Experience: Jira Builder zpyher Web and mobile testing API testing and 2 8 years |   more..

Devashish

Mobile: +91 91884 77559
Location: Rajasthan, Online (Canada)
Qualification: Graduation in B.tech

Experience: Flutter Android Java Dart Kotlin Ios app development Flutter developement Firebase Git Version control  more..

Satheesh

Mobile: +91 91884 77559
Location: Tamil Nadu, Online (Canada)
Qualification: BE

Experience: The HR Manager I hope this message finds you well Following your recent job posting for the Python Developer position  more..

Haseen

Mobile: +91 89210 61945
Location: Kollam, Online (Canada)
Qualification: Btech in applied electronics and instrumentation

Experience: Software testing   more..

Aradhna

Mobile: +91 91884 77559
Location: Madhya Pradesh, Online (Canada)
Qualification: Graduation or diploma in graphic designing

Experience: Logo design Social media post design Certificate design Visiting card design Digital card design Brouchers design |   more..

Vinodha

Mobile: +91 91884 77559
Location: chidambaram, Online (Canada)
Qualification: M.C.A

Experience: java Seleniunm manual testing and Automation testing  more..

Shravan

Mobile: +91 98474 90866
Location: Telangana, Online (Canada)
Qualification: B. Tech

Experience: Expertise in Manual testing and writing Test cases and Test scenarios And Finding the bugs in the application Expertise in  more..

Kalyan

Mobile: +91 91884 77559
Location: Durgapur, West Bengal , Online (Canada)
Qualification: Hs pass

Experience: Ui ux designing E commerce page design Logo visiting card Banner Illustration   more..

saurabh

Mobile: +91 98474 90866
Location: Maharashtra, Online (Canada)
Qualification: Master's

Experience: Python Full stack developer | Resume for   more..

Abhinav

Mobile: +91 9446600368
Location: Noida, Online (Canada)
Qualification: MCA

Experience: white box testing black box testing test cases API testing PostmanApplication for Software Testing  more..

Deepak

Mobile: +91 89210 61945
Location: Ooty, Online (Canada)
Qualification: M.Sc.Computer Science

Experience: MANUAL Tester with 1 5 Years of experience with Jira & Test rail management tool (Functional and acceptance testing)  more..

Alex

Mobile: +91 91884 77559
Location: Tamil Nadu, Online (Canada)
Qualification: MCA

Experience: I'm python Full stack developer in django and React MongoDB MySQL git i know skills and I have 2 4  more..

Sumit

Mobile: +91 9895490866
Location: Uttar Pradesh, Online (Canada)
Qualification: B Tech

Experience: Strong programming knowledge of Android SDK Services Android API’s GPS XML JSON REST SOAP Push Notification(GCM) Social Integration (Facebook Twitter  more..

SRINIVASA

Mobile: +91 91884 77559
Location: Andhra Pradesh, Online (Canada)
Qualification: B-Tech in ece

Experience: Manual testing and selenium with java  more..

Vasim

Mobile: +91 91884 77559
Location: Andhra Pradesh, Online (Canada)
Qualification: Bachelor degree

Experience: I have good skills in python and recently i completed a project in python Project name: password generator For this  more..

Success Stories

The enviable salary packages and track record of our previous students are the proof of our excellence. Please go through our students' reviews about our training methods and faculty and compare it to the recorded video classes that most of the other institutes offer. See for yourself how TechnoMaster is truly unique.

Photos of Training / Internships

Internship/projects in canada
Internship/projects in canada
Internship/projects in canada
Internship/projects in canada
Internship/projects in canada
Internship/projects in canada
Internship/projects in canada
Internship/projects in canada
Internship/projects in canada
Internship/projects in canada
Internship/projects in canada
Internship/projects in canada

Trained more than 10000+ students who trust Nestsoft TechnoMaster

Get Your Personal Trainer